引言

需求评审是项目管理中的一个关键环节,它直接关系到项目的成败。有效的需求评审可以帮助团队更好地理解项目目标,确保项目按照预期进行。然而,许多项目在需求评审环节出现了问题,导致项目延期、成本超支、甚至失败。本文将深入探讨需求评审的重要性,分析常见陷阱,并提供实用的策略来确保项目成功。

需求评审的重要性

1. 明确项目目标

需求评审有助于团队对项目目标达成共识,确保所有成员对项目期望的理解一致。

2. 降低项目风险

通过评审,可以发现潜在的风险和问题,从而提前制定应对措施,降低项目风险。

3. 优化资源分配

明确的需求有助于合理分配资源,提高项目效率。

常见需求评审陷阱

1. 缺乏明确的需求定义

如果需求定义不明确,团队成员可能会产生误解,导致项目实施过程中出现偏差。

2. 忽视用户需求

过分关注技术实现,而忽视用户实际需求,可能导致项目偏离用户期望。

3. 缺乏沟通

团队成员之间、与客户之间沟通不畅,可能导致需求理解偏差。

4. 评审流程不规范

缺乏规范的评审流程,可能导致评审效率低下,问题发现不及时。

如何确保需求评审有效

1. 明确需求定义

  • 使用用户故事、用例等工具,将需求具体化、可视化。
  • 与客户充分沟通,确保需求准确无误。

2. 关注用户需求

  • 定期与用户沟通,了解他们的需求和期望。
  • 将用户需求作为项目评审的核心。

3. 加强沟通

  • 建立有效的沟通渠道,确保团队成员、客户之间信息畅通。
  • 定期召开需求评审会议,及时解决问题。

4. 规范评审流程

  • 制定规范的评审流程,明确评审步骤和时间节点。
  • 采用多种评审方法,如同行评审、专家评审等。

实例分析

以下是一个简单的实例,说明如何进行需求评审:

项目背景

某公司计划开发一款在线教育平台,为用户提供在线学习课程。

需求定义

  • 用户可以注册、登录账户。
  • 用户可以浏览、搜索课程。
  • 用户可以在线学习课程,并完成课后练习。
  • 用户可以对课程进行评价和评论。

需求评审

  1. 组织需求评审会议,邀请团队成员、客户代表参加。
  2. 逐项评审需求,确保需求明确、可行。
  3. 针对需求中的问题,与客户进行充分沟通,明确解决方案。
  4. 形成需求评审报告,总结评审结果。

总结

需求评审是项目成功的关键环节,通过明确需求定义、关注用户需求、加强沟通和规范评审流程,可以有效避免常见陷阱,确保项目顺利实施。在实际操作中,应根据项目特点和需求,灵活运用各种方法和工具,提高需求评审的效率和效果。